#9df3d2 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#9df3d2 is composed of 61.6% red, 95.3% green and 82.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 35.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 13.6% yellow and 4.7% black. It has a hue angle of 157 degrees, a saturation of 78.2% and a lightness of 78.4%. #9df3d2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#3be7a5. Closest websafe color is: #99ffcc.

● #9df3d2 color description : Very soft cyan - lime green.
The hexadecimal color #9df3d2 has RGB values of R:157, G:243, B:210 and CMYK values of C:0.35, M:0, Y:0.14,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 10351570.
